Northumberland County Council is the lead partner for the Ashington Regeneration Programme, with funding provided by a number of different sources. As part of this Regeneration Programme, the Council seek to appoint an exceptional cultural and creative professional team to design and deliver a distinct series of cultural events and activities that engage local people and businesses, attract visitors and complement the Ashington Investment Plan objectives. Community engagement will be at the heart of the Animating Ashington project with a focus on children and young people. Specifically, the project will: • Appoint a cultural and creative professional team or company to develop and deliver a distinct programme of intergenerational cultural inspired performance events and responses that activate, animate and mobilise the town centre, with an overall programme theme based on colour, animation and the high street. • Increase activity to the town’s current offer including activation of existing and proposed new sites to demonstrate potential through a programme of events concentrated throughout the year. Expanded activities could include festivals, makers, craft and lifestyle markets, projections, lighting events and engaging performances that give residents new reasons to visit the town centre and add to the appeal of Ashington as a destination for rail users from summer 2024. • Increase the understanding of the town’s culture and consider contemporary responses to support a future focused approach and vision to reimagine the purpose and function of the town. • Encourage business collaboration particularly with those trading in the town centre to foster a culture of working together to present the diversity of offer and ability of the town centre to promote Ashington as a destination. • Increase civic pride, encourage public participation and create a legacy and local ownership of annual events via partnership working and an asset-based approach. • Support audience development, establish and nurture connections to residents, schools and local businesses.
